Practical Designer Notes for Production

To ensure your finished product meets professional standards, careful preparation is essential. Here are critical considerations when working with this digital embroidery file:

  1. Thread Colors: Test thread colors on both light and dark fabrics. Golden yellows, deep oranges, and soft creams work well for a warm, autumnal/holiday feel, while silver or white threads can create a wintery, elegant look.
  2. Stitch Density: Check the stitch density before mass production. Dense areas may require adjustments if placed on thick towels or stretchy garments to prevent puckering.
  3. Hoop Size: Confirm the recommended hoop size to ensure the design fits your chosen product dimensions. Centering is crucial for symmetry, especially on apparel and home décor items.
  4. Stabilizer Selection: Use the proper stabilizer for each fabric type. Cut-away stabilizers are often best for stretchy materials like sweatshirts, while tear-away may suffice for woven cottons.
  5. Fabric Texture: Consider the fabric texture. Smooth fabrics highlight the detail of the embroidery, while textured fabrics may obscure fine details. Choose wisely based on the desired aesthetic.
  6. Small Details: Review small details after stitching. If the design includes tiny elements, ensure they remain visible and do not merge together during the embroidery process.

Areas for Caution

While Honeycomb Embroidery is versatile, there are scenarios where it requires careful handling. Avoid using this design on extremely small hoop sizes if it contains intricate details that might become lost. Be cautious with metallic threads, as they can sometimes cause tension issues depending on the machine. Additionally, items that need repeated washing, such as kitchen towels, should be stitched with durable threads and proper backing to maintain longevity.

Layered details on curved caps or dense stitch areas may also present challenges. Always conduct a test run on a scrap piece of the actual fabric to verify tension and alignment.
